The Anaheim Convention Center (ACC) reigns as the largest exhibit facility on the West Coast, having hosted such large, well-attended events as the Winter NAMM Show, Disney's D23 Expo and Citrix Synergy. Originally opened in 1967, the ACC currently spans 53 acres and the offers 1.6 million square feet of function space and many dynamic features. The ACC completed its seventh expansion in Fall of 2017, providing an additional 200,000 square feet of flexible meeting space to our guests.
Under general supervision serves as the field supervisor to the Parking Lot Cashiers and Parking Lot Attendants; performs a variety of duties including the oversight of parking lot operations, customer service and public safety watches.
This is a part-time position that usually averages 20 hours per week. A minimum number of hours is not guaranteed. Availability to work evenings, weekends and holidays is highly desireable.

Essential Functions
The following functions are typical for this classification. Incumbents may not perform all of the listed functions and/or may be required to perform additional or different functions from those set forth below to address business needs and changing business practices.
Monitor the handling of money by the parking lot cashiers to ensure proper handling and accountability.
Operate a city vehicle to drive to and observe the operation of events and the performance of event staff to ensure they maintain order in assigned areas.
Respond to guest regarding complaints; ensure customer service needs are met and adhere to the policies and guidelines of the Anaheim Convention Center.
Monitor the prevention of unauthorized vehicles entering parking areas during public events and non-contracted facility areas at anytime.
Obtain knowledge of types of events reporting to and the clientele attending.
Respond to adverse situations quickly, determine the best course of action and implement any changes needed.
Perform related duties and responsibilities as required.
Qualifications
Experience: Journey level experience as a Parking Lot Attendant or prior experience supervising events and event personnel.
Knowledge of: Principles and practices of supervision.
Ability to: Communicate effectively and deal diplomatically with the public, supervisors and fellow employees; uphold established policies and guidelines; climb up and down stairs, walk, and stand for extended periods of time; maintain availability to permit scheduling during weekdays, weekends, and holidays as assigned.
License/Certification Required: Possession of a valid California Driver’s License by date of appointment.
Physical Conditions: Due to the nature of work assignments, incumbents must be able to stand and walk for extended periods of time.
